NFL Competition Committee Considers Longer PAT Attempts
Posted on 3/4/14 at 7:42 am
Posted on 3/4/14 at 7:42 am
quote:A 20 yard try would give way to a 42 yard try. I don't know how I feel about such a drastic change, especially in terrible weather conditions. Maybe they could make it a 35 yard try, or spot the ball at the 18 yard line.
NFL.com reports the league's competition committee has discussed a proposal that would move extra-point attempts from the two- to 25-yard line.
That means PATs would go from 19 to 42 yards in length. Kickers converted 1,262-of-1,267 extra-point attempts last season, good for a staggering 99.6 conversion rate. The play has become so automatic as to be pointless. Making PATs longer would place a greater emphasis on finding and keeping good kickers, as well as encourage more two-point conversion attempts. Although we're on board with modifying the extra point, automatically awarding seven points and reverting to six if a team fails on a two-point conversion may make more sense.
I guess I'm all for making the extra point more than just a formality. But the drasticness of this change seems excessive.
